Where Can a Psychiatric RN Work in New Hampshire and What Can They Expect?

As a Registered Nurse specializing in psychiatric care in New Hampshire, you’ll find diverse opportunities across various facilities, including community mental health centers, inpatient psychiatric hospitals, outpatient clinics, and residential treatment programs. Your role may involve conducting thorough assessments, developing individualized care plans, and providing therapeutic interventions to individuals dealing with mental health challenges. Additionally, you may have the chance to collaborate with interdisciplinary teams, including psychologists, social workers, and psychiatrists, to foster patient recovery in settings that range from acute care environments to supportive outpatient services. Travel Psychiatric Intensive Care RN assignments in Westbrook, ME place you at a 100-bed free-standing psychiatric hospital specializing in acute mental health care for adults and adolescents. The hospital features a dedicated 6-bed psychiatric intensive care unit designed for patients with complex behavioral health needs. The unit primarily serves individuals with thought disorders, psychosis, personality disorders, and manic episodes. Recommended skills include crisis intervention, teamwork, and familiarity with psychiatric electronic medical records. Westbrook is a welcoming community just outside Portland, Maine’s largest city, which is about a 15-minute drive away. The area offers easy access to Portland’s vibrant arts, dining, and coastal attractions, making it an appealing destination for travelers. To qualify, you must have current RN licensure, strong de-escalation skills, and experience working with acute adult mental health patients. COVID SERIES, BOOSTER REQUIRED AT TIME OF SUBMISSION Location: 111 Middleton Road Danvers MA 01923 Psych RN needed for 12H nights – 7p-7a The Danvers Treatment Center is a detoxification program dedicated to helping men and women by providing 24 hour nursing care to monitor an individual’s withdrawal from alcohol and/or other drugs and alleviate symptoms. Clients are provided with the medical and emotional support that they need during the one of the most pivotal stages in the recovery process. The Nurse (RN) position is a great opportunity for someone who wants to make a critical impact in the lives of those who are struggling with addiction. The Detox Nurse’s Responsibilities Are: Records and reports all observed symptoms, reactions to treatments and changes in patients safety status Collaborates with team in providing health information and maintains clients’ medical records Responds to patient care needs/issues and assists patients with activities of daily living, promoting a positive therapeutic environment Assists with the admitting, discharge and transfer process Participates in treatment team meetings & assists with development of care plans Administers medications to patients Qualifications: Valid and current Massachusetts licensure as a Registered Nurse Current certification in CPR Experience with addiction treatment services preferred, but not required.
